The GM-Stage3 is neither certified, or covered under warranty, and as I posted yesterday, anything beyond that setup has been proven to wreck parts starting with the upper ring land...
IIRC bluecobalt had that exact problem ~ GMPP stated that anything above 301bhp, puts too much pressure on the upper ring land, and requires aftermarket pistons...
It also stated that GMPP didn't put more boost into the Stage 3, because it created too much heat, which caused other issues...
The GMPP Stage 3 (or the Trifecta version of it) needs all the (GM) Stage 2 components to work ~ but it's the added features that make the GM Stage3 that much cooler IMHO;
The integrated nitrous dry shot, and user calibrated variable rev limit is freaking cool...
The Trifecta version of the Stage 3 simply offers as standard fare, the A/C to be enabled, and if you pay more, it is offered in an HTP tunable format...
